With the wire wool and water, would you add salt in too or is it just the wool and water...
@morrieskustoms64306 жыл бұрын
J Griffiths the solution is half white vinegar and half peroxide, no water or salt. just mix the 2 together and chuck in some chopped up steel wool. to apply just dab it on.
